> I have few stations running mars_nwe servers and dosemu accessing resources
> of these servers. After upgrading kernel from 2.6.4 to 2.6.16 every
> operation on mars_nwe disks is very slow (copying 13MB of data takes at
> least 1 minute!). Even more... it have tendency to stuck for a moment while
> accesing mars_nwe disk :(
> Has anyone know what can be reason of such behaviour?
I found solution to this problem. I changed $_hogthreshold to sth more than 1.
Then it took to much CPU power - over 50%. Then I changed $_rdtsc to (on) and
now I takes less than 40%.
I'm curious what happend? My old config was good for over 5 years without
changing till these kernels :/
